About us

We are an innovative supplier of infrastructure inspection, engineering, and field repair and reinforcement services for the global electrical utility, renewables, lighting, and wireless telecommunications industries. Operating from our headquarters near Houston, Texas Exo brings an unsurpassed level of knowledge, experience, and excellence to every project that we undertake. Our dedicated team of experts (engineers, field service personnel, inspectors and sales/support staff) are passionate about our jobs knowing that they are assisting in our client’s efforts to ensure structural integrity of their infrastructure assets.     What is a “premature failure”? And what would cause it? A premature failure happens when a new utility structure fails long before the end of its lifecycle. Most of the catastrophic failures Exo investigates are "premature failures" due to issues in manufacturing, construction, assembly, erection, etc. (not a wind or weather event, nor design issues). Many of these structures are between 10 and 15 years old and are not considered to be aging infrastructure. What do you do about it? Third-party QA/QC services will help you catch costly quality escapes before they leave the plant and prior to the manufacturer’s warranty expiring (and financial liability transferring hands).
